| VMWare Smashes $1 billion Quarter |
24 Jan 12 |
| Virtualisation behemoth VMWare has surpassed financial predictions to smash the $1 billion barrier in the fourth quarter of 2011.
The scale of VMware's virtual server revenue stream now rivals IBM's Power Systems and System z mainframe physical server businesses (individually) and, according the The Register, is roughly the same size as the systems business at Oracle, and larger than the Itanium-based server business at HP. |
| Hyper-V Supports CentOS |
17 May 11 |
| Microsoft has added support for another Linux server distribution with its Hyper-V virtualisation software, its latest move to compete better with virtualisation market leader VMware.
Customers can now run the CentOS flavour of Linux as a guest operating system in supported Windows Server 2008 R2 Hyper-V environments, Sandy Gupta, general manager for marketing in Microsoft's Open Solutions Group, was due to announce at the Open Source Business Conference. |
